    Understanding Lawn Mower Oils

    Lawn mower oils play a crucial role in maintaining your mower’s performance and longevity. Different types of oil serve specific purposes, and knowing your options helps you make informed choices.

    Types of Lawn Mower Oils

    • Conventional Oil: This oil type is derived from crude oil and offers adequate protection for most lawn mowers. It’s suitable for casual users who mow occasionally.
    • Synthetic Oil: Made from chemical compounds, synthetic oil provides superior protection against wear and tear. It performs better in extreme temperatures and offers greater resistance to breakdown.
    • Synthetic Blend: This oil combines conventional and synthetic oils. It offers improved protection compared to conventional oil while maintaining an affordable price point.

    Benefits of Synthetic Oil

    • Enhanced Protection: Synthetic oil reduces wear, helping engines last longer. It maintains viscosity under various conditions, which is crucial for optimal engine performance.
    • Better Temperature Stability: Synthetic oils perform well in both high and low temperatures. This quality permits easier starting and efficient operation during winter and summer.
    • Reduced Emissions: Many synthetic oils lead to cleaner combustion, reducing harmful emissions while also promoting environmental health.

    Choosing the Right Oil for Your Toro Mower

    Check your Toro lawn mower manual for the recommended oil type. Use oils that meet the specification guidelines to ensure proper functionality. If using synthetic oil, ensure its compatibility with your engine type. Synthetic oils generally fit modern engines, but older models may require conventional oil.

    Oil Change Frequency

    • Every 50 Hours of Use: Change oil every 50 hours, especially during the mowing season. This routine keeps your engine running smoothly.
    • Seasonal Changes: At the start of each mowing season, change the oil. Fresh oil removes contaminants that accumulate during storage.
    • Monitor Oil Level: Regularly check your oil level, especially before large mowing jobs. Maintaining optimal levels prevents engine damage.
    • Use the Correct Oil Filter: If your mower has a filter, replace it during oil changes. A clean filter ensures only fresh oil circulates through the engine.
    • Dispose of Old Oil Properly: Follow local guidelines for oil disposal to avoid environmental harm. Many auto parts stores offer recycling programs for used oil.

    Toro Lawn Mower Specifications

    Understanding the specifications of your Toro lawn mower helps ensure optimal performance and maintenance. Refer to the details below to find relevant information regarding oil types and manufacturer guidelines.

    Recommended Oil Types

    Toro recommends using high-quality oils that meet specific performance standards. You can choose from the following options:

    • Synthetic Oil: Provides superior protection, enhances performance, and allows for longer intervals between oil changes.
    • Conventional Oil: Suitable for standard use, often less expensive than synthetic oil.
    • Synthetic Blend: Combines benefits of both synthetic and conventional oils, offering moderate performance enhancement at a lower cost compared to full synthetic.

    Always check your owner’s manual for the specific oil type recommended for your model.

    Manufacturer Guidelines

    Follow these manufacturer guidelines to ensure your Toro lawn mower runs efficiently:

    • Oil Viscosity: Typically, a 10W-30 or 5W-30 oil is suitable for most Toro models. Refer to your manual for exact specifications.
    • Oil Change Interval: Change the oil every 50 hours of use or at the start of each mowing season to maintain engine performance.
    • Oil Filter: Use the correct oil filter and replace it during oil changes for optimal function.

    Adhering to these guidelines contributes to the longevity and reliability of your Toro lawn mower.

    Frequently Asked Questions

    Can synthetic oil be used in Toro lawn mowers?

    Yes, synthetic oil can be used in Toro lawn mowers. It offers enhanced protection, better temperature stability, and improved engine performance. Always refer to your mower’s manual for specific oil compatibility.

    What are the benefits of using synthetic oil in lawn mowers?

    Synthetic oil provides superior lubrication, reduces engine wear, and allows for longer intervals between oil changes—up to 100 hours or more. It also leads to smoother and quieter engine operation.

    How often should I change the oil in my Toro lawn mower?

    It is recommended to change the oil every 50 hours of use or at the beginning of each mowing season. Regular checks and changes ensure optimal performance and longevity.

    What types of oil are suitable for Toro mowers?

    Toro mowers can use synthetic oil, conventional oil, or synthetic blends. Each type serves different purposes, so always check the mower manual for the recommended oil specifications and viscosity.

    What oil viscosity is recommended for Toro lawn mowers?

    The recommended oil viscosities for Toro lawn mowers are typically 10W-30 or 5W-30. Always consult your mower’s manual to confirm the right viscosity for your specific model.

    How do I dispose of used oil from my Toro mower?

    Used oil should be disposed of properly by taking it to a recycling center or a hazardous waste disposal facility. Many local auto parts stores also accept used oil for recycling.

    What should I check regarding the oil filter for my Toro mower?

    Always use the correct oil filter as specified in your mower’s manual. A proper filter helps maintain engine performance and prolongs the life of your mower by ensuring effective oil filtration.
